How Willie Randolph's Singles Compares to Similar Players

Willie Randolph totaled 1,775 career Singles, well above the league average of 344.9 — a mark that ranked among the best of his era. His best Singles season came in 1989, posting 135, well above the league average of 47.6 that year. The lowest point came in 1975 at 9, well below the league average of 39.3 that year. Production slipped through the final seasons. The Singles total went from 83 in 1990 to 124 in 1991 and 58 in 1992, falling over the span. The decline marked the closing chapter of the career. Significant season-to-season variance characterizes the Singles profile — ranging from 9 to 135 — though the career average remained well above league norms.
